Registered Nursing/Registered Nurse is a vocational program in the area of Health Services/Allied Health/Health Sciences. Registered Nursing/Registered Nurse is a program that generally prepares individuals in the knowledge, techniques and procedures for promoting health, providing care for sick, disabled, infirmed, or other individuals or groups. Includes instruction in the administration of medication and treatments, assisting a physician during treatments and examinations, Referring patients to physicians and other health care specialists, and planning education for health maintenance.
In United States, 807 schools offers the Registered Nursing/Registered Nurse program. The average tuition & fees of these schools offering Registered Nursing/Registered Nurse is $8,999 for academic year 2021-2022. In average, students have received $4,653 financial aid and students to faculty ratio is 16.70 to 1. The average graduation rate is 40.11% and 5,551 students enrolled into each school in average.
